9.87582E+12在数据存储中占多少字节?

在数据存储领域,对存储空间的精确掌握至关重要。其中,了解不同数据类型在存储中所占用的空间是基础中的基础。本文将深入探讨一个特定的数值——9.87582E+12,分析其在数据存储中占据的字节数。通过对这一数值的分析,我们将更好地理解数据存储的原理和计算方法。

首先,我们需要明确9.87582E+12是一个科学计数法表示的数值。科学计数法是一种表示非常大或非常小的数字的方法,其基本形式为a×10^n,其中1≤|a|<10,n为整数。因此,9.87582E+12实际上表示的是9.87582乘以10的12次方。

接下来,我们将探讨在数据存储中,这个数值所占用的字节数。为了得出答案,我们需要了解数据在存储过程中是如何表示的。在计算机中,数据通常以二进制形式存储,即由0和1组成。因此,我们需要将9.87582E+12转换为二进制形式,再计算其所占用的字节数。

首先,将9.87582E+12转换为十进制形式。这个过程可以通过简单的数学运算完成,即9.87582乘以10的12次方。计算结果为9875820000000。

接下来,将9875820000000转换为二进制形式。这个过程需要使用二进制转换算法,例如除以2取余数法。通过这个算法,我们可以得到9875820000000的二进制表示为1111000100001100111010001001000010000111100。

最后,计算二进制表示所占用的字节数。在计算机中,每个字节由8位二进制数组成。因此,将二进制表示的位数除以8,即可得到所需的字节数。对于9875820000000的二进制表示,其位数为40位,除以8得到5字节。

综上所述,9.87582E+12在数据存储中占用5字节。这一结论可以帮助我们更好地理解数据存储原理,以及在存储过程中如何合理分配空间。

在实际应用中,了解数据类型在存储中所占用的空间具有重要意义。以下是一些案例分析:

  1. 案例分析一:假设我们有一个包含10亿个9.87582E+12数值的数组。在存储这个数组时,我们需要为每个数值分配5字节。因此,整个数组所需的存储空间为50亿字节,即大约500MB。

  2. 案例分析二:假设我们正在开发一个大型数据库,其中包含大量的9.87582E+12数值。在这种情况下,了解每个数值所占用的空间有助于我们优化数据库结构,提高查询效率。

  3. 案例分析三:在云计算领域,数据存储成本是用户关注的焦点之一。了解不同数据类型在存储中所占用的空间,可以帮助用户合理分配资源,降低成本。

总之,了解数据类型在存储中所占用的空间对于数据存储和优化具有重要意义。通过本文的分析,我们得出了9.87582E+12在数据存储中占用5字节的结论。这一结论有助于我们更好地理解数据存储原理,以及在实际应用中优化存储空间。

猜你喜欢:故障根因分析